Prof. Raj Senani
Education
Raj Senani was born at Budaun, Uttar Pradesh, India on 14 March, 1950. He received B.Sc (1966) from Lucknow University, B.Sc.Engg (1971) from Harcourt Butler Technological Institute (H.B.T.I), Kanpur University, and M.E.(Honors) (1974) and Ph.D (1988), both in Electrical Engg, from Motilal Nehru Regional (M.N.R.) Engineering College, University of Allahabad, India.
Academic positions held
Dr. Senani held the position of a Lecturer (1975-1986) and Reader (1987-1988) at the Electrical Engg Department of M.N.R. Engg College, Allahabad. He joined the Department of Electronics and Communication Engg of the Delhi Institute of Technology (DIT; now renamed as Netaji Subhas Institute of Technology (NSIT)) in 1988 as an Assistant Professor and initiated and set up the Linear Integrated Circuits (LIC) Lab. He became a full Professor in 1990 and was named as the first Head of the ECE Department under which all the three UG programs (namely, Electron. and Commun. Engg, Comp. Engg and Instrum. and Control Engg) were conducted initially.

Current Teaching and Research interests
Professor Senani's current teaching and research interests are in the areas of:
- Analog VLSI Circuits
- Analog Signal Processing
- Bipolar and CMOS Analog Circuits
- Analog Filter Design
- Current-mode Circuits and Techniques
- Current Conveyors, their variants and applications
- Oscillator Synthesis
- Active simulation of Inductors and Voltage-Controlled Impedances
- Electronic Instrumentation
- Chaotic Nonlinear Dynamical Circuits
- SPICE Simulation and Modeling
- Translinear/Log Domain Circuits
Research publications
From some of his research in the above areas, he has authored and co-authored over 100 research papers which have been published in IEEE (USA), IEE(UK) and other International journals of repute. Almost all of his publications have been widely referred by other researchers working in the same areas; several of these have been cited in books also.
